Annie Get Your Gun

1950 · Movie · NR · 107 min · ★ 6.7 · 89% critics

MusicComedyRomanceWestern

A talented young sharpshooter joins a traveling Wild West show after beating the troupe’s star marksman. As the act grows into a sensation, friendly competition turns into a romantic push-and-pull, with pride and showbiz pressures testing their partnership on and off the stage.

About

You’ll likely enjoy this if you want a bright, song-packed classic musical with flirtatious one-upmanship and big showbiz spirit, like The Harvey Girls or Kiss Me Kate; Not for you if dated stereotypes or broad comedy bother you.

Pros: classic Irving Berlin songs; colorful, upbeat energy; playful rivalry romance | Cons: thin, draggy story; uneven lead performance; dated cultural portrayal
